AI in Renewable Energy Optimization

One prominent area where AI is making a difference is in the optimization of renewable energy sources. By predicting energy demand and supply more accurately, AI helps in efficiently managing resources like wind and solar power. A study conducted by Stanford University highlights how AI algorithms have improved the efficiency of energy consumption in smart grids by up to 10%.

AI’s Role in Carbon Capture

AI is also paving the way for advancements in carbon capture technology. By analyzing geological data, AI helps in identifying optimal sites for carbon storage, enhancing the effectiveness of these initiatives.

How does AI help in reducing energy consumption?

AI algorithms analyze energy usage patterns to optimize and reduce unnecessary consumption, making systems more efficient.

Can AI predict climate change impacts accurately?

While AI can analyze data to predict trends, it complements rather than replaces traditional climate models, offering enhanced insights.

What is the role of AI in disaster management?

AI improves the accuracy of weather forecasts and helps in early warning systems, aiding in better disaster preparedness.
